Workshop on Techniques of Collection and Utilization of Biological Parameter Data incorporating best practices that are developed within the framework of the ECO-MARPOL platform

18th February 2023


On February 18, 2023, the Department of Oceanography and Marine Sciences of the University of the Aegean organized an online seminar (webinar) targeted at undergraduate and postgraduate students. The seminar focused on Techniques for Collecting and Utilizing Biological Parameter Data, incorporating best practices that will be developed within the ECO-MARPOL platform. The seminar was held online by UAEGEAN-MAR, also including other aspects of the EN.I.R.I.S.S.T. infrastructure platform.

During the event, there were seven (7) presentations, followed by questions from the audience. The seminar concluded with an extensive discussion and interesting conclusions.
